A fleet is a grouping of ships that sails together under the same banner. They are frequently used by organizations like the navy, during their Buster Calls, in which a number of affiliated ships are summoned to deal with a significant issue. It stands to reason that, in most cases, the fleets in One Piece are a good deal more powerful than a single ship.

Pirates are also users of fleets, though how powerful they are varies on a case-by-case basis. The Krieg Pirates, despite boasting 5,000 men on 50 ships, managed to lose all but their flagship after an encounter with Mihawk. Nonetheless, some fleets are fairly reputable in battle, and many powerful pirates make good use of them. These are the most powerful pirate fleets in One Piece.

Golden Lion Pirates

Airbound Fleet

  • Captain: Shiki
  • Subordinate Crews: Amigo Pirates (Non-Canonically), At Least 49 Other Crews

Shiki, alongside the likes of Linlin, Newgate, and Kaido, was a former subordinate to Rocks D. Xebec. Once the Rocks Pirates disbanded, Shiki founded his own crew, said to be the strongest of Roger’s era, who terrified the Grand Line in their prime. Shiki’s Devil Fruit, the Fuwa Fuwa no Mi, allows him to levitate virtually any non-living thing, alongside himself, allowing his flagship island to float in the air. Despite his apparent reputation, however, Shiki is no stranger to defeat.

He challenged the Roger Pirates once Gol D. Roger refused to join his armada and even gained the upper hand. However, a freak storm wiped out half of his fleet, and Shiki ultimately lost to Roger. Shiki ended up being incarcerated in Impel Down but escaped by cutting off his legs and replacing them with his swords as prosthetics. Non-canonically, he rebuilt his fleet in One Piece: Strong World and the filler episodes surrounding it. He added a number of mutated animals to this incarnation, adding to its potency. Nonetheless, this version was defeated by the Straw Hat Pirates.

Red Hair Pirates

Strong Core But Externally Weak

  • Captain: Shanks
  • Subordinate Crews: Social Club, Bourgeois Pirates, Puddle Pirates, Night Butterfly Pirates, and at least one other crew

“Red Hair” Shanks is one of the most powerful pirates in the One Piece series. A pirate since his youth and an early inspiration for Luffy, Shanks has long had a level of established power. He is considered a viable challenger to most pirates who share his rank of Emperor, and he may be the strongest of those currently active. His crew itself is also fairly remarkable, including the likes of the intelligent Ben Beckmann, the sharpshooting Yassop, and the surprisingly flexible Lucky Roux among its senior officers.

But while Shanks and his crew have a level of dominance, his subordinates are, by New World standards, fairly weak, diluting the fleet’s overall power. Despite his lack of mercy towards enemies, Shanks is known to have a generous side that was shown early on with Luffy. It is possible that lending his banner to fairly weak crews is a method of protecting them, similar to how other pirates with the rank of Emperor “claim” territories with this exact intention.

Straw Hat Grand Fleet

An Alliance Of Crews

  • Captain: Monkey D. Luffy
  • Subordinate Crews: Beautiful Pirates, Barto Club (?), Happo Navy, Ideo Pirates, Tontatta Pirates, New Giant Warrior Pirates, Yonta Maria Grand Fleet

Monkey D. Luffy is the captain of the Straw Hat Pirates. His own crew tends to be fairly small but powerful, with each of its members being fairly skilled in combat and particularly distinguished in their own specific fields. Despite not even becoming an Emperor at the time of its formation, Luffy inadvertently inspired a pirate fleet of his own after his time in Dressrosa. Many figures in the Corrida Colosseum were baited with the Mera Mera no Mi and ended up being turned into toy automatons by Sugar after their loss.

It was thanks to the intervention of one “God” Usopp, who knocked out Sugar by making a truly pained face, that these various combatants regained their freedom. Once the fighting in Dressrosa had ceased, those involved who stayed loyal to the Straw Hats declared allegiance to Monkey D. Luffy, allowing him to call on their aid in times of need. Luffy himself was somewhat discontent with the idea, as he preferred a smaller crew. In essence, he retooled the organization to an alliance, adding the caveat that any “subordinate” in need of assistance should simply ask him for help when they need it as well.

The fleet is somewhat large, boasting 5,640 members in total, with the individual crews varying in size. While two crews had fewer than ten total members, another two were large enough to constitute fleets of their own. There is also a level of diversity amidst the ranks, with dwarves and giants being among those currently affiliated. That said, the crew has yet to debut in its entirety. While all of its captains and a majority of prominent members fought alongside the crew at Dressrosa, crews like the New Giant Warrior Pirates and Yonta Maria Grand Fleet are still not significantly detailed.

Further complicating matters is the apparent sinking of the Barto Club during an altercation with the Red Hair Pirates, making it unclear whether they are still a factor in the group. An incomplete incarnation of the Straw Hat Grand Fleet was able to take on most of the Donquixote Pirates, so who knows what a full-fledged version of the group can manage?

Beasts Pirates

A Menagerie Of Crews

  • Captain: Kaido
  • Subordinate Crews: None at present, Donquixote Pirates (formerly)

Kaido was a figure of great fear for most of his time as a pirate. The World Government repeatedly struggled to capture him and failed to kill him. Other pirate crews were single-handedly decimated at his hand. His own crew, the Beasts Pirates, integrated a number of other crews into its roster. While there are no explicitly affiliated “subordinate” crews active at present, many officers within the Beasts Pirates, namely half of the Flying Six among others, were former captains themselves, seemingly letting their crews filter into the Beasts Pirates, rather than retaining any direct authority over them specifically.

Kaido’s crew found themselves defeated by the Ninja-Pirate-Mink-Samurai Alliance, itself a collaborative effort between the Straw Hat Pirates, the Heart Pirates, the Momoko Dukedom, and the Kozuki Family. Eventually, additional forces, including the Kid Pirates and many Beasts Pirates defectors, also joined. A combination of circumstances led to the crew losing a significant level of power, with Kaido currently being incapacitated and two of his All-Stars, among others, currently being in naval custody.

Big Mom Pirates

A Massive Formation

  • Captain: Charlotte Linlin
  • Subordinate Crews: Unclear

Charlotte “Big Mom” Linlin boasts the massive crew known as the Big Mom Pirates. Consisting of her many children among others, the crew inhabits the 35-island archipelago known as Totto Land. In addition to her children, many of whom are strong enough to boast the rank of officer or higher, Big Mom has an army of homies, sentient soul-infused inanimate objects, among her subordinates. Beyond her own crew, Big Mom is known for her tactical arranged marriages. She has wedded her children to powerful figures in order to effectively strongarm them into becoming her subordinates. Yet in the few displayed instances, this has led to defections, with said crews, including the wedded children, betraying the crew and escaping Big Mom’s authority.

That said, the crew, even in its current capacity, has shown itself to be one with many powerful figures commandeering the ranks. Even so, a number of Worst Generation members have shown themselves capable of defeating its strongest members, putting a relative cap on just how strong the crew is. Big Mom herself was recently incapacitated alongside Kaido, further limiting the exact power the crew holds overall.

Whitebeard Pirates

44-Crew Fleet

  • Captain: Edward Newgate
  • Subordinate Crews: Maelstrom Spider Pirates, Little Pirates, A O Pirates, 40 Other Crews

At their height, the Whitebeard Pirates were a truly massive crew. Edward “Whitebeard” Newgate was an orphan who yearned for a family growing up on the poverty and crime-ridden island of Sphinx. It was likely for this reason that he accrued a massive number of crewmates. Whitebeard’s primary crew was large enough that it required 16 Division Commanders at its height. Whitebeard also poached at least one crew, the Spade Pirates, effectively integrating all of its members, including its captain, Portgas D. Ace, who became the 2nd Division Commander.

Newgate also employed many subordinate crews. At least five of his former crewmates left the crew but decided to remain loyal to their former captain, with their crews serving under his. An additional 38 crews also served under Whitebeard, though it was mostly their captains who were seen during the Summit War.

The crew suffered a rapid decline following the deaths of Ace and Whitebeard during the Summit War. The remnants of the crew were led by 1st Division Commander Marco, in the Payback War, where they were defeated by the Blackbeard Pirates. After this event, Blackbeard became one of the Four Emperors, annexed the majority of Whitebeard’s territory, and effectively led to the crew’s disbanding. Edward Weevil, the alleged son of Whitebeard, has since defeated at least one former pirate captain who was affiliated with Newgate, with the anime depicting several others.

Blackbeard Pirates

Arguably The Strongest Fleet In All Of One Piece

  • Captain: Marshall D. Teach
  • Subordinate Crews: Peachbeard Pirates, other crews

The Blackbeard Pirates were founded by Marshall D. Teach, a former subordinate of Whitebeard. Teach killed 4th Division Commander Thatch and stole the Yami Yami no Mi he discovered, effectively concluding a 26-year mission to join the crew for the sole purpose of stealing it. Teach initially selected a small handful of subordinates to join his crew, with half of them being picked from Impel Down in the aftermath of a battle to the death. After killing Whitebeard and stealing his Devil Fruit, Teach has steadily grown in power.

His main crew is massive enough to necessitate divisions, with his initial nine crewmates and the ex-Marine Admiral, Kuzan, becoming the Ten Titanic Captains. Additionally, they are said to have subordinate crews, with the Peachbeard Pirates being identified as one while in conflict with the Revolutionary Army. Ultimately, they were strong enough to wipe out the remnants of the Whitebeard Pirates so badly that they ended up disbanding. Since then, they have shown no signs of slowing down, and all their pivotal players are currently intact.
